Overview
- James picked up his $52.6 million player option for 2025-26 with his no-trade clause preserved
- Agent Rich Paul emphasized that James made no trade or contract extension request
- Four NBA teams have reached out about potential trades, but discussions have remained at an exploratory stage
- Rich Paul notified Lakers GM Rob Pelinka and Luka Doncic’s business manager of James’s decision and statement in advance
- James’s camp is evaluating whether the Lakers’ post-free agency roster led by Luka Doncic meets championship-contender standards
